30:9-37.  Communicable disease hospital;  location;  bonds
    The board of chosen freeholders of any county, whenever in its judgment the  public need requires, may acquire land by purchase, condemnation, gift or otherwise anywhere in the county and erect thereon suitable buildings to be used as a hospital for communicable diseases and to furnish and maintain the same.  No building in which patients are housed, shall be located within less than two hundred and fifty feet of any public highway, or of any dwelling house  or other inhabited building.  For the purpose of this section county bonds may  be issued and sold to an amount not exceeding one-tenth of one per centum  (  1/10   of 1%) of the county ratables.

     Amended by L.1953, c. 148, p. 1362, s. 1.
